I have been a PC user for many years and am tired of all the problems with it. I read the article in the July issue of Electronic Musician on building a personal studio. They described a system with a PC running Gigastudio and the main computer a Mac G4. I plan on purchasing the system described.
Base Configuration: Dual 1.25GHz-512MB-
120 GB SuperDrive
ATI Radeon video card
Extra RAM: 512MB 266Mhz PC2700 DDRRAM
SCSI Card: Adaptec 29160N Ultra-160
1 st Drive: 60 GB ATA, System Drive
2nd Drive: 73 GB SCSI 10k RPM , Audio Drive
Rack Chassis: Marathon G-Rack
Audio Hardware: Frontier Design Dakota/Tango24
Misc. Hardware: TC Electronics PowerCore
Sequencing Software: MOTU Digital Performer
Cost: $ 8295.20
Vendor: http://www.wavedigital.com/
My question's
Has anyone purchased a computer from this company? or know anything about them?, Is the cost resonable?.
I have seen a software program called Virtuial PC that is designed to run PC software on the Mac. I have a lot of music PC programs, will they run on the Mac with this program. If so, mabey I can run Gigastudio this way.
